Quantitative insights into the spatio‐temporal variation of Atlantic salmon (Salmo salar) biomass in a river catchment using eDNA metabarcoding

open access: yesJournal of Fish Biology, EarlyView.
Abstract Effective species conservation and management requires comprehensive biomonitoring, enhanced by combining traditional and newer methodologies, such as environmental DNA (eDNA) analyses. A seasonal pulse of spawning adult Atlantic salmon (Salmo salar) was detected by normalised eDNA 12S reads from metabarcoding, which facilitated estimation of ...

The maize mitogen‐activated protein kinase kinase kinase gene ZmMAPKKK45 is associated with multiple disease resistance

open access: yesNew Phytologist, EarlyView.
Summary Southern leaf blight (SLB), caused by the necrotrophic fungus Cochliobolus heterostrophus, is a major foliar disease of maize (Zea mays) world‐wide. A genome‐wide association study was performed to dissect the genetic basis of SLB resistance in maize. Functional validation was performed using mutant and transgenic analyses.
